Careers after a Degree in Public Relations, Advertising, and Applied Communication
A Degree in Public Relations, Advertising, and Applied Communication leads to careers as
- Advertising and Promotions Managers
- Public Relations Managers
- Fundraising Managers
- Fundraisers
- Communications Teachers, Postsecondary
- Public Relations Specialists
- Human Resources Managers
- Training and Development Managers
- Training and Development Specialists
- News Analysts, Reporters, and Journalists
- Health Education Specialists
- Community Health Workers
- Agents and Business Managers of Artists, Performers, and Athletes
- Entertainers and Performers, Sports and Related Workers, All Other
- Broadcast Announcers and Radio Disc Jockeys
